# Deploybot (Herald) — Environments

Herald posts deploy status to team channels. Three environments: dev, staging, prod. Each has its own bot token and channel routing; never point dev at prod channels. Staging mirrors prod config minus alerting. Deploys to prod require the release channel to be unmuted. As a contractor you'll mostly touch dev. Its current configuration is listed here.

deployment values, yadug-bawif:
[framir]
team = pelox
access_code = ac_a38ab2
owner = tamion.julael
host = framir.tolvaqlabs.test
port = 11211
peer = tammir.zemvargrid.local
salt = 2215ef03
pin = 1541

### Changed defaults — Gatewick LB health checks (v4.2)

Heads up for release: we tightened the default health-check behavior behind the Gatewick load balancer. Interval dropped from 30s to 10s, unhealthy threshold is now 2 consecutive failures instead of 5, and the probe path moved to the lightweight readiness endpoint so we stop hammering the full status page. Old deployments inherit these on next restart — no manual action, but expect faster ejection of flaky nodes. The new default configuration values are as follows.

deployment values, yagug-fahap:
[frador]
port = 9000
region = south-4
host = frador.nelvrolabs.internal
timeout_ms = 1000
retries = 2

☐ HSM delivery — Branchfield off-site

The Cravenor HSM arrives Wednesday via Ironquay Secure Transit, tamper-evident case, two seals. Verify seal numbers against the advance sheet before signing. Move the unit directly to the cage; no interim storage. Two staff present at all times. The courier is instructed to release the case only upon the exchange stated below.

handover note for yagef-bagep: the drudor pelius courier leaves the kasdor zorvan norir ledger at gate 8016 under passcode 755406

The Mapwrenth address autocomplete widget reads its settings from the project .env file at build time, so any change requires a rebuild. Set AUTOCOMPLETE_REGION to the two-letter region code your deployment serves, and AUTOCOMPLETE_DEBOUNCE_MS to control how quickly suggestions fire — 250 is a sensible default for most markets. Results are cached locally for ten minutes. The widget authenticates to the Mapwrenth suggestion service on every uncached lookup, so the service credential must be present. Add it on the next line of .env.

sealed setting: LEDGER_TOKEN13=5d842615a26d7